Time Limits

In a number of states, asbestos sufferers are given a short time to file mesothelioma lawsuits. The laws of the state are known as statutes of limitations and they define deadlines for filing a personal injury or wrongful death claim.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ist patients and their families determine the statute of limitations that applies to their specific case. The applicable statute could depend on several aspects, including the victim's place of residence and the place of employment. It can also differ depending on where the asbestos exposure was experienced, and what asbestos companies or work sites are involved.

The "clock" of the statute of limitations typically begins when a person was aware or should have been aware that exposure to asbestos could cause a serious injury. In mesothelioma, this is usually the date of diagnosis. However, in some circumstances the clock can start earlier. For example in the case of a chronic condition like asthma that requires medication on a constant basis and limits their activities, the clock may start earlier.

If a mesothelioma victim or a family member dies prior to the statute of limitations has expired, the estate can still file for compensation against the parties responsible. These claims are typically granted to pay funeral expenses as well as lost income. past discomfort and pain.

Finally, a mesothelioma lawyer can assist you in filing claims for compensation from the asbestos trust funds. Asbestos-related companies that were found to be responsible for asbestos exposure were reorganized by Chapter 11 bankruptcy laws and created these trusts in order to pay mesothelioma patients.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can provide you with the trusts' names and assist you in filing for compensation.
